Pitchbox Alternatives for Outreach and Link Building

Find a Pitchbox alternative for prospect research, outreach management or both. Compare campaign capacity, contact history and the work needed before you send a pitch.

If you are evaluating a replacement for Pitchbox, you need to account for prospect research as well as the outreach your team manages. Pitchbox charges for campaigns run and prospecting searches. Pro is $300 a month, or $210 billed yearly, for 25 campaigns and 1,000 searches. The next tier is $600 for 1,000 campaigns and 5,000 searches. The top one is $1,200.

People leave when the price stops matching what they send, when what they wanted was a contact database and not a sending tool, or when it turns out the real problem was finding prospects worth emailing in the first place.

BuzzStream, if the cost per user is the problem

BuzzStream is the closest like-for-like platform and starts far lower. $49 a month gets you one user, 500 stored contacts, 30 prospecting searches a month and 50 Discovery results per search. $174 gets 3 users, 25,000 contacts and 250 searches. $424 gets 6 users, 100,000 contacts and 1,000 searches. From $999 you get 12 or more users and 300,000 or more contacts. Extra users cost $58 and $70.

Read the meter, because it is not Pitchbox's meter. BuzzStream charges for the contacts sitting in its CRM, so a large historic database costs you money every month whether or not you email any of it. Pitchbox charges for campaigns you actually run.

Big list, low send volume: Pitchbox is usually cheaper. Small list, sending constantly: BuzzStream usually wins. Work out which one you are before switching.

BuzzStream also sells ListIQ, an AI-driven media list builder, priced separately.

Hunter fixes bounced email

Hunter is not an outreach platform and it fixes a different failure. It finds email addresses at a domain and tests whether they accept mail. The meter is credits a month: 50 free, then 2,000, 10,000 and 25,000, with verification costing half a credit. Unlimited users on every plan.

If your Pitchbox campaigns are failing on bounces and not on volume, this is your fix. It sits beside a sender. It does not replace one.

BuzzSumo has the journalists

Link outreach and press outreach are two different jobs. BuzzSumo PR & Comms at $299 a month gives you five users, five alerts, and a Media Database for finding and contacting journalists writing about your brand, your market and your competitors. Coverage Reports show publication data, engagement, mention counts and where in the article you turned up.

Pitch reporters by beat and you want a media database. Neither Pitchbox's prospecting nor OppAlerts' site contacts will stand in for one.

Ahrefs Brand Radar may already be paid for

Brand Radar advertises web mention tracking and link prospecting alongside the backlink index, so a team already on Ahrefs may have the prospecting half without buying anything. It sends no outreach, so you still need a sender.

OppAlerts, for deciding who is worth contacting

OppAlerts sends nothing. It answers the question that comes before a campaign: which placements exist, and which ones justify the effort.

  • Prospect Index, searched by meaning as well as keyword and filtered by opportunity type: guest contribution pages, resource lists, expert roundups, podcasts, industry directories, award programs and speaking submissions. Meaning search returns relevant pages that never use your phrasing.
  • Site Info, returning the contact pages, emails, phone numbers and social profiles a site publishes about itself. Published details, never tested for deliverability. That is Hunter's job.
  • PageRank history, monthly link-graph measurements for a host, its www variant and its domain, so you see which way a site is heading before you invest in the relationship.
  • Backlinks DB: Link Gap, listing sites with observed links to competitors you name and no observed link to you.
  • Brand Unlinked Mentions, listing pages that already name your business and did not link. Highest-yield list you will get, because the publisher already knows who you are.

All of it runs off one campaign definition covering the business, its brands, its competitors and three buyer personas. The same definition drives AI answer tracking, keyword tracking, coverage monitoring and content scoring.
